South Africa
South Africa – with a population of over 43 million inhabitants – is the southern-most country on the African continent. South Africa has a number of ethnic groups which are all of interest to the BLAC FOUNDATION. Of particular interest, however, is the history and culture of the Zulu of KwaZulu-Natal.
